44 /*! \file
45  * This file was adapted from the NetBSD project's source tree, RCS ID:
46  *    NetBSD: getopt.c,v 1.15 1999/09/20 04:39:37 lukem Exp
47  *
48  * The primary change has been to rename items to the ISC namespace
49  * and format in the ISC coding style.
50  */

80 /*!
81  * getopt --
82  *	Parse argc/argv argument vector.
83  */
84 int
isc_commandline_parse(int argc,char * const * argv,const char * options)85 isc_commandline_parse(int argc, char *const *argv, const char *options) {
86 	static char *place = ENDOPT;
87 	const char *option; /* Index into *options of option. */
88 
89 	REQUIRE(argc >= 0 && argv != NULL && options != NULL);
90 
91 	/*
92 	 * Update scanning pointer, either because a reset was requested or
93 	 * the previous argv was finished.
94 	 */
95 	if (isc_commandline_reset || *place == '\0') {
96 		if (isc_commandline_reset) {
97 			isc_commandline_index = 1;
98 			isc_commandline_reset = false;
99 		}
100 
101 		if (isc_commandline_progname == NULL) {
102 			isc_commandline_progname = argv[0];
103 		}
104 
105 		if (isc_commandline_index >= argc ||
106 		    *(place = argv[isc_commandline_index]) != '-')
107 		{
108 			/*
109 			 * Index out of range or points to non-option.
110 			 */
111 			place = ENDOPT;
112 			return (-1);
113 		}
114 
115 		if (place[1] != '\0' && *++place == '-' && place[1] == '\0') {
116 			/*
117 			 * Found '--' to signal end of options.  Advance
118 			 * index to next argv, the first non-option.
119 			 */
120 			isc_commandline_index++;
121 			place = ENDOPT;
122 			return (-1);
123 		}
124 	}
125 
126 	isc_commandline_option = *place++;
127 	option = strchr(options, isc_commandline_option);
128 
129 	/*
130 	 * Ensure valid option has been passed as specified by options string.
131 	 * '-:' is never a valid command line option because it could not
132 	 * distinguish ':' from the argument specifier in the options string.
133 	 */
134 	if (isc_commandline_option == ':' || option == NULL) {
135 		if (*place == '\0') {
136 			isc_commandline_index++;
137 		}
138 
139 		if (isc_commandline_errprint && *options != ':') {
140 			fprintf(stderr, "%s: illegal option -- %c\n",
141 				isc_commandline_progname,
142 				isc_commandline_option);
143 		}
144 
145 		return (BADOPT);
146 	}
147 
148 	if (*++option != ':') {
149 		/*
150 		 * Option does not take an argument.
151 		 */
152 		isc_commandline_argument = NULL;
153 
154 		/*
155 		 * Skip to next argv if at the end of the current argv.
156 		 */
157 		if (*place == '\0') {
158 			++isc_commandline_index;
159 		}
160 	} else {
161 		/*
162 		 * Option needs an argument.
163 		 */
164 		if (*place != '\0') {
165 			/*
166 			 * Option is in this argv, -D1 style.
167 			 */
168 			isc_commandline_argument = place;
169 		} else if (argc > ++isc_commandline_index) {
170 			/*
171 			 * Option is next argv, -D 1 style.
172 			 */
173 			isc_commandline_argument = argv[isc_commandline_index];
174 		} else {
175 			/*
176 			 * Argument needed, but no more argv.
177 			 */
178 			place = ENDOPT;
179 
180 			/*
181 			 * Silent failure with "missing argument" return
182 			 * when ':' starts options string, per historical spec.
183 			 */
184 			if (*options == ':') {
185 				return (BADARG);
186 			}
187 
188 			if (isc_commandline_errprint) {
189 				fprintf(stderr,
190 					"%s: option requires an argument -- "
191 					"%c\n",
192 					isc_commandline_progname,
193 					isc_commandline_option);
194 			}
195 
196 			return (BADOPT);
197 		}
198 
199 		place = ENDOPT;
200 
201 		/*
202 		 * Point to argv that follows argument.
203 		 */
204 		isc_commandline_index++;
205 	}
206 
207 	return (isc_commandline_option);
208 }
